Introduction: Several assignments in this course require you to have a GSLIS account and to use it, so that you will gain experience in working in a Unix-based environment, setting up Webpages, and uploading and downloading files. This assignment provides an opportunity for you to gain some knowledge of the account early on and to set up class email to your preferred address. The GSLIS account is where you will post your Web pages and experiment with Pine, which is the Unix-based GSLIS email system. You may also set up an email account with the University of Texas at Austin (viz., mail.utexas.edu).
